Testimony of Judith (Elias) Sefarari, born in Athens, Greece, 1926, regarding her experiences in Athens while using a false identity Her childhood in a traditional family. German occupation, 27 April 1941; life during the German occupation; her brother joins the EAM underground; obligation to register in the Jewish community, September 1943; selling of property in order to purchase forged documents; details about the Recanati brothers; move to another suburb; deportation of her mother to Auschwitz; her sister is hidden in the home of a Greek woman; receives help from the Red Cross; receives help from the Greek population; finds a hiding place in a cemetery, July 1944; end of the war. Aliya to Israel, 1949.
